Transaction 71b8e198dfb5dc7d69a4f5a063631e26faa6e65e425899400626429de80ef024
1 Input
2 Outputs
- 71b8e198dfb5dc7d69a4f5a063631e26faa6e65e425899400626429de80ef024:0
- 71b8e198dfb5dc7d69a4f5a063631e26faa6e65e425899400626429de80ef024:1
value 25557
address 33WZmy7XhrgMgx6ReEgy8s8RMJ7gzcRpd8
value 820685
address 12qhfrZXDUF71RcX4BM79B6GtupHKkWCtn